International Initiatives

Inria International Labs

Inria Chile / CIRIC. Since 2012, Emmanuel Pietriga is the scientific leader of the Massive Data team at Inria Chile, working on projects in collaboration with the ALMA radio-telescope and the Millenium Institute of Astrophysics.

Informal International Partners
  • Japan Advanced Institute of Science and Technology (JAIST): René Vestergaard on the interactive visualization of complex networks in molecular biology.

  • Microsoft Research: Nathalie Henry Riche and Bongshin Lee on defining the value of interaction on complex visualization systems. Participants: Anastasia Bezerianos.

  • Northwestern University: Steven Franconeri and Steve Haroz on understanding the impact of animations on interactive visual exploration. Participants: Anastasia Bezerianos.

  • University of Konstanz: Daniel Keim and Johannes Fuchs on mapping out the design space for visualization glyphs. Participants: Anastasia Bezerianos.

  • Universidad Carlos III de Madrid: Teresa Onorati and Paloma Diaz on the visualization of tweet feeds related to crisis events using a wall display, so as to help crisis monitoring and management. Participants: Anastasia Bezerianos, Emmanuel Pietriga.
